Florida Opens New Immigrant Detention Site Dubbed 'Deportation Depot'

Florida has opened a new immigrant detention site, which has been informally named the “Deportation Depot,” where detainees are currently being held, according to state officials. The facility’s location and capacity were not immediately disclosed by authorities. The naming of the site as the “Deportation Depot” reflects the contentious and emotional nature of immigration detention in the United States.

The decision to establish this new detention center comes amidst ongoing debates about immigration policies and practices. While supporters argue that such facilities are necessary for enforcing immigration laws and border security, critics raise concerns about the conditions within these detention centers and the overall treatment of detainees.

Unnamed sources within the state government have indicated that the “Deportation Depot” is part of broader efforts to address the increasing number of undocumented immigrants in Florida. The identity and status of the detainees currently held at the facility have not been made public, raising questions about transparency and accountability in the immigration enforcement process.
